LAX Taxiway P

The Taxiway P Project consists of the construction of a new 3,600 FT crossfield taxiway. It will be built through an area currently occupied by hangars, aprons, service roadways, and a tunnel. This project is being built in 13 phases, many of which are being constructed simultaneously requiring extensive logistical and labor management coordination with all stakeholders to manage overlapping work.  

In order to make room for the new taxiway, Aldridge’s scope of work includes the removal of electrical equipment and services in existing buildings, aircraft aprons, high mast lighting, and fiber optics. Aldridge is also responsible for airfield lighting as well as ductbank and structures. This includes extensive modifications to the existing airfield lighting circuitry and re-routing public works power ductbank feeders.
